More Ways to be Passive Aggressive

For more on this topic, also see: My Back Up PlanĀ 

Great. Just what the people of my generation need. Not only can we be passively involved in each other’s lives via social networking and completely avoid direct communication by being able to send people to voicemail (is there anything more infuriating) and text messaging, now we can avoid telling people if we’ve possibly given them an STD with a new site called InSpot, a site that allows you to send someone an anonymous message telling them that you caught a little something and that they should go go get tested. They even link the person to local resources. So Yeah. You can tell someone you may have given them herpes. Or chlamdyia. Or gonorrhea. Or whatever. By an e-card. Extremely adult, right?
